It’s not trying good for Tesla’s Cybertruck vary extender


The Cybertruck Vary Extender was introduced on the automobile’s supply occasion as a $16,000 add-on that seems to take up about half of the truck’s usable rear mattress area. Tesla initially promised in 2019 that the tri-motor Cybertruck would go greater than 500 miles on a cost for about $70,000 — and that’s with none point out of an add-on battery.

Now, the very best vary Cybertruck obtainable for order is the 325-mile dual-motor AWD mannequin for $79,990, and the tri-motor “Cyberbeast” goes 301 miles for $99,990. Beforehand, Tesla promised the battery would stretch the Cybertruck’s vary to 470 miles, however the estimation was downgraded in 2024.

As of this writing, the battery extender continues to be talked about within the Cybertruck specs part of the location, and there’s no indication that it has been cancelled altogether. But it surely’s not trying good for the accent, because it was initially alleged to change into obtainable in “early 2025,” after which was delayed to “mid 2025,” and now appears to be lacking in motion.

Tesla has been amassing a $2,000 non-refundable charge from prospects to order the battery extender, and it’s unclear what Tesla will do with the cash if the battery doesn’t come to market.
